Introduction

The coatings industries play a critical role across multiple end-use sectors, including construction, automotive, aerospace, packaging, electronics, and marine. These industries not only provide functional protection—such as corrosion resistance, thermal stability, and UV shielding—but also enhance product aesthetics and brand value.

With the rise of sustainability goals, digital manufacturing, and advanced surface technologies, the global coatings market is undergoing a profound transformation.

Market Overview

The global coatings market was valued at over USD 190 billion in 2024, and is expected to surpass USD 250 billion by 2030, driven by:

  • Infrastructure spending in emerging economies

  • Demand for high-performance and eco-friendly coatings

  • Innovations in nanotechnology and functional surfaces

  • Growth in EVs, 5G infrastructure, and lightweight materials

Sustainable Coatings on the Rise

Sustainability is a major driver in the coatings industry, leading to a shift from solvent-based to waterborne, powder, and bio-based coatings. Companies are investing in:

  • Low-VOC and zero-VOC formulations

  • Recyclable and biodegradable raw materials

  • UV-curable and energy-efficient curing systems

Major coatings manufacturers such as PPG, AkzoNobel, Sherwin-Williams, Nippon Paint, and Axalta are aligning their portfolios with global ESG standards and green chemistry principles.

Regional Market Insights

China

World’s largest coatings market, led by architectural and industrial segments. Focus on energy-saving coatings and infrastructure-related demand.

United States

Strong growth in automotive refinishing, wood coatings, and protective coatings. ESG policies pushing waterborne coatings adoption.

Germany

Innovation hub for industrial and powder coatings. Focus on functional performance, automation, and VOC regulation compliance.

Japan & 🇰🇷 South Korea

Known for advanced coatings in electronics, semiconductors, and displays.

Investment and M&A Trends

  • Strategic acquisitions are reshaping the coatings landscape, especially in Asia and specialty coatings

  • Key deals include: AkzoNobel acquiring Grupo Orbis (Latin America), PPG acquiring Tikkurila (Nordics)

  • Startups in nano-coatings and bio-based resins are attracting VC and corporate investment
